Q: Is 47,304,250 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 47,304,250 is a composite number.

Why is 47,304,250 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 47,304,250 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 7 10 14 25 35 50 70 125 175 250 350 875 1,750 27,031 54,062 135,155 189,217 270,310 378,434 675,775 946,085 1,351,550 1,892,170 3,378,875 4,730,425 6,757,750 9,460,850 23,652,125 and 47,304,250, with no remainder.

Since 47,304,250 cannot be divided by just 1 and 47,304,250, it is a composite number.
